YEREVAN, JUNE 20, NOYAN TAPAN. Garnik Margarian, Chairman of the
Homeland and Honor Party, stated in his interview with a Noyan Tapan
correspondent that Anthony Godfrey’s statement, in essence, is a
"yellow card" to the Armenian government.

It should be mentioned that, according to A. Godfrey’s statement,
the U.S. is anxious about the development of relations between Armenia
and Iran.

In G. Margarian’s opinion, such a position of the U.S. can be
conditioned by lack of progress in the issue of the settlement of
the Nagorno Karabakh conflict and, in particular, by another meeting
between the two presidents which yielded no results.

Besides, in G. Margarian’s words, the U.S. finally made sure that the
regime established in Armenia first of all serves Russia and not them
and this statement of A. Godfrey could be made in the context of the
current aggravation of relations between Russia and the West.
